dreamweaver心得体会-梦之维心得体会
作为深耕 Web 前端开发领域十余年的资深从业者,笔者见证了网页设计技术的迭代飞速发展。从早期的静态页面构建到如今的动态交互生态,Dreamweaver 虽已不再作为主流开发平台普及,但其构建的“初级网页”基础依然深刻影响着无数前端学习者的思维模式。本文旨在回顾 Dreamweaver 的辉煌历程,剖析其核心功能,并结合行业现状,为有志于掌握网页设计工具的同学提供一份详尽的实操指南。通过案例解析与技巧分享,本文希望读者能不仅理解技术原理,更能掌握解决实际问题的思维方法。

网页设计与开发是互联网行业的基石之一,而 Dreamweaver 作为曾经构建网站的重要工具,其设计理念始终围绕“可视化配置”展开。尽管随着 XHTML 和 CSS 规范的日益成熟,以及 browsers(浏览器)和 JavaScript(脚本)能力的极大提升,Dreamweaver 已逐渐边缘化,但它曾代表的“所见即所得”(所见即所得)理念,极大地降低了普通用户构建网站门槛。对于许多初学者而言,掌握 Dreamweaver 的核心操作逻辑,理解其模块化的工作流程,是踏入 Web 开发世界的必经之路。本文将从多个维度深入探讨 Dreamweaver 的心得体会,力求帮助读者建立系统的知识框架。
Dreamweaver 的官方理念主张通过直观的拖拽界面,让用户以图形化的方式完成网页的搭建,而非繁琐的代码输入。这种设计初衷旨在让非技术人员也能轻松发布内容,但其实现路径却依赖于对 HTML、CSS 和 JavaScript 的底层理解。在实际使用中,你会发现每一个页面元素都对应着特定的代码模块,这种“所见即所得”的操作模式,虽然简化了最终代码的编写,但要求操作者必须深刻理解每一行的代码含义。
例如,当你放置一个图片时,你不仅是简单的拖拽,更是确认了该元素的属性设置是否符合你的设计要求。这种模块化思维要求开发者必须具备极强的逻辑分析能力,能够预判元素在页面中的层级结构及其相互关系。
十年耕耘中,笔者深刻体会到 Dreamweaver 的模块化管理极大地提高了工作效率。通过合理布局,可以将复杂的页面构建过程分解为多个独立的步骤,如主体内容、侧边栏、导航栏等,每个模块都可以单独编辑和调整。这种灵活性的优势在于,当某一模块出现设计变更时,无需重新构建整个页面,只需针对性地修改该模块代码即可。这也要求使用者具备较强的代码阅读与修改能力。一旦过度依赖可视化操作,容易导致代码结构混乱,缺乏必要的冗余,从而给后期的维护和扩展带来隐患。
因此,良好的编程习惯是弥补“所见即所得”潜在缺陷的关键。
在具体的应用实践中,Dreamweaver 的模块化设计为网页的构建提供了清晰的思路。无论是首页还是复杂的专题页面,都需要按照一定的逻辑结构进行排列。这种逻辑性贯穿了从内容录入到样式设定的全过程。
例如,在设置导航栏时,首先要确定导航内容的顺序,接着按照顺序设置链接文本,最后才考虑背景颜色等视觉效果。这种由内而外的构建顺序,不仅符合人类的认知习惯,也确保了网页结构的严谨性。通过这种结构化的思维方式,开发者可以有效避免后期因逻辑错误导致的返工现象,从而提升整体开发质量。
,Dreamweaver 的设计理念核心在于“可视化”与“模块化”的完美结合。它试图在降低学习门槛的同时,保持开发的专业性。对于初学者而言,深入理解这一设计理念,是掌握网页设计工具的前提。只有掌握了背后的逻辑,才能真正从“会拖拽”进阶到“会设计”,从而成为优秀的 Web 开发者。
网页的视觉呈现是用户体验的第一关,而布局与样式则是实现这一目标的核心手段。在 Dreamweaver 的众多功能中,布局与样式设置占据了极高的比重。初学者往往容易陷入细节,但高手则懂得大局观。通过运用 Dreamweaver 提供的网格系统和对齐工具,可以快速构建出整齐划一的页面结构。无论是复杂的表格布局还是现代的内联样式,背后的原理都是为了让文本、图像、音视频等元素在页面上呈现出最佳的视觉效果。
在实际操作中,布局的合理性至关重要。一个页面如果元素随意放置,不仅影响美观,更可能破坏用户的阅读体验。
例如,在设置侧边栏时,如果将关键信息置于页面顶部而非底部,或者将导航栏随意放置在主内容之上,都会导致信息层级混乱。
因此,开发者必须熟练掌握 Dreamweaver 的各种对齐和分布工具,确保每个元素都位于其合理的逻辑位置。
于此同时呢,图形的选择与编辑也是布局设计的一部分。通过调整图片的压缩比例、添加边框或更换背景色,可以极大地提升页面的整体质感。
形式追随功能,布局设计必须服务于内容表达。在编写网页时,不能为了美观而牺牲信息的清晰度。
例如,在设置导航栏时,如果过多的装饰元素遮挡了菜单链接,或者色彩搭配过于花哨,都会增加用户的认知负荷。
因此,优秀的布局设计需要在美观与清晰之间找到完美的平衡点。这需要开发者具备敏锐的观察力和对内容的深刻理解,能够根据页面主题调整布局风格,如严谨的新闻站使用左侧图文混排,而娱乐类的网站则可能采用活泼的布局设计。
此外,样式设置的精细度也直接影响网页的最终呈现效果。通过调整字体大小、颜色、行距以及阴影效果,可以使页面看起来更加专业、整洁。特别是在处理长文本时,合理的行距设置能有效缓解视觉疲劳。在具体的项目实施中,开发者需要不断尝试不同的样式组合,并依据反馈进行微调。这种试错过程虽然耗时,但却是提升设计水平的必经之路。只有经过大量实践积累,才能形成自己独特的设计风格,从而创造出具有吸引力的网页内容。
,元素布局与视觉呈现是网页设计的重要组成部分。它要求开发者既要有严谨的结构意识,又要有灵活的审美感知。通过熟练掌握 Dreamweaver 的布局与样式功能,可以将抽象的内容转化为具体的视觉语言,从而为用户呈现一个直观、易读且美观的网页界面。这一过程不仅是技术的运用,更是艺术感的体现。
随着互联网技术的发展,网页早已不再是静态的信息展示,而是集信息、交互与功能于一体的多媒体平台。在 Dreamweaver 的演进过程中,动态功能的实现一直是用户关注的焦点。通过引入 JavaScript 和 ActionScript 等脚本技术,网页可以实现表单验证、页面跳转、动态图表生成、在线游戏等丰富功能,极大地提升了用户的参与感。
在交互设计的初期阶段,开发者首先需要明确用户的需求。这决定了交互功能的范围与复杂度。
例如,一个购物网站可能只需要基础的购物车功能,而一个在线教育平台则可能需要丰富的互动测验和即时反馈机制。Dreamweaver 提供的对话框和工具栏为开发者提供了丰富的交互选项,如按钮、下拉菜单、下拉框等,这些控件是构建复杂交互界面元素的基础。
在实际操作中,交互功能的实现往往需要借助 Dreamweaver 自带的脚本编辑器或集成在其中的脚本调试工具。开发者需要将动态逻辑与静态页面相结合,确保脚本执行时不会干扰用户的正常浏览体验。
例如,在设置表单验证时,必须确保提示信息准确且易于阅读,避免给用户造成误导。
除了这些以外呢,交互元素的响应速度也直接影响用户体验,过重的脚本代码可能导致页面加载缓慢,从而引发用户流失。
为了优化交互体验,开发者还需注重细节处理。如图片的加载方式、动画过渡效果等,都需要通过适当的代码设置来控制。在 Dreamweaver 中,可以通过链接图片的大小和加载方式,确保图片在用户下载过程中不会造成性能问题。
于此同时呢,合理的布局设计也是交互体验的重要保障,避免在交互过程中出现页面抖动或跳转失败的情况。
值得一提的是,Dreamweaver 在动态功能的支持上也经历了不断的迭代升级。早期的版本可能功能有限,而随着 XHTML 2.0 和 CSS3 等标准的普及,其支持的功能日益强大。特别是在移动端适配方面,Dreamweaver 也提供了相应的方案,帮助开发者在多种设备上保持一致的交互体验。这使得网页能够真正服务于全球用户,打破地域和设备的限制。
,交互体验与动态功能的实现是 Web 应用的核心竞争力之一。它要求开发者不仅掌握基础的工具操作,更要具备编程思维和系统观念。通过灵活运用 Dreamweaver 的脚本功能,让静态网页“活”起来,为用户提供更加丰富、智能的交互体验,是当代网页设计的重要方向。
在漫长的开发生涯中,性能优化一直是开发者不断追求的目标。网页的加载速度直接关系到用户的使用时长和网站的转化率。Dreamweaver 虽然提供了可视化的调试工具,但在性能优化方面仍需结合专业工具使用。通过合理压缩资源、优化代码结构和合理使用缓存,可以有效提升页面的加载速度。
资源的压缩是性能优化的关键。图片、字体、CSS 文件等资源的体积直接决定了加载时间。开发者应学会使用 Dreamweaver 提供的压缩功能,去除冗余代码,并进行合适的格式转换。
于此同时呢,避免在网页中嵌入过多的脚本或外部依赖库,以减少不必要的网络请求。
代码结构的优化同样重要。合理的 HTML 结构与 CSS 分离,能够提高代码的可读性和可维护性,从而减少因代码错误导致的无效重排和重绘。在互动性较强的页面中,应避免在关键节点反复调用 JavaScript,必要时可以利用浏览器缓存功能帮助用户加速页面加载。
此外,针对特定场景的性能优化策略也不容忽视。
例如,在处理视频资源时,应采用流式播放技术或优先加载关键帧,避免大文件阻塞页面;在设置表单时,应确保输入控件的优先级高于其他元素,以减少用户提交前的无效操作。
虽然 Dreamweaver 在性能优化方面的功能不如专业工具如 Chrome DevTools 强大,但其基本的压缩和缓存管理功能已经能够满足大多数开发需求。
随着浏览器技术的不断演进,开发者也应保持对性能优化的敏感度,适时引入更专业的工具进行深度优化。这种持续学习的态度,有助于在激烈的市场竞争中保持技术优势。
,性能优化是提升网页质量的重要环节。它要求开发者在追求功能与美观的同时,兼顾速度与效率。通过合理的管理与优化,可以让网页在第一时间为用户提供流畅的使用体验,从而赢得用户的好感与信任。

